A low-level teamwork hybrid model based swarm intelligent algorithm for engineering design optimization

• A new low level teamwork hybrid model based WIFN algorithm is proposed. • A new stagnation phase is added to overcome local optima stagnation problem. • The algorithm is successfully tested on CEC 2014, CEC 2017, CEC 2019 and CEC 2020 benchmarks. • WIFN is analyzed for constrained engineering design and image thresholding problems. • Experiments and statistical results show that WIFN is efficient and effective.
